Riding for a Cause: The Thrilling 2024 Camp Quality Motocyc Event

Revving engines, dusty trails, and the camaraderie of riders united for a noble cause – the 2024 Camp Quality Motocyc Event promises an exhilarating journey. Set to kick off in March next year, this event is more than just a rally; it’s a heartfelt endeavor to support Camp Quality’s mission while embarking on an unforgettable adventure.


A Journey with Purpose

The scenic route mapped out for this event weaves through picturesque landscapes, starting from Heatherbrae and heading towards Armidale, then to Port Macquarie, before looping back to Heatherbrae. What makes this event unique is its inclusivity – riders can choose between an on-road or off-road component, ensuring an engaging experience for all participants, regardless of their riding preferences or skill levels.


The Heart Behind Camp Quality

Before delving into the adrenaline-pumping ride that awaits, understanding the cause behind the event adds depth to the journey. Camp Quality is an organization dedicated to supporting children and families affected by cancer. Through various programs and initiatives, they aim to bring joy, resilience, and positivity to the lives of those facing this challenging journey. The Motocyc Event serves as a significant fundraiser, rallying support and funds to bolster these impactful endeavors.
